(3) The solution (alternative/resolution to the conflict)

To resolve a conflict is indeed an extremely challenging job. It requires correct understanding of the
causes of conflict and inexhaustible degree of patience. In order to resolve the issue, one should
acquaint oneself thoroughly with its history as well as its historical, political, social and economic roots.
The fifth episode of Season of the series entitled, Madame Secretary showed an intense conflict
between the three nations namely the United States, Iran and Canada. Elizabeth, the Secretary of the
United States of America, understand that one should be very clear that real resolution of the conflict
can be brought about only through a just solution in which some often called it as a “win-win situation”.
It must be noted that during a bilateral, trilateral or multilateral conflict that concerned parties should
feel that they have gained something, and not or at least should have the spirit of give and take. To
resolve the conflict among nations, Allen Bollings, the Negotiator of the Mideast Peace Talks, proposed a
solution and that was to engage such military actions to Iran. Elizabeth disagreed to his proposal and
believed that such coercively imposed solution can never be a lasting solution. A conflict can be said to
have been resolved only if it is freely acceptable by all parties concerned. Thus, the Secretary of the
United States of America managed to secretly meet the Iranian Ambassador Javani to offer him
alternative solution to the problem. She made a deal to him that the United States will lift the ban on
trade of commercial plane parts in exchange for Iran to shut down the reactor. In the case of Canada
and United States, the Secretary did a research on the Canadian pipeline in which the proposal was
deemed to be fabricated; but the President still approved it since he wanted to have a legacy. Elizabeth
throughout the whole episode created a strategy and it is to try and find elements which can create a
common ground or common agenda which can build confidence for the sides to work together. As what
stated earlier, there’s a spirit of give and take relationship to a win-win situation. Madam Secretary
understood that Security is often is the first priority and much conflict is aggravated by lack of trust. In
addition she also applied rationality in resolving the conflicts not by mere personal interests and
considered sequencing or to consider introducing an agreement in stages whereby each action is
dependent on another action
